In your view, what is the primary function and purpose of GALA? How can the association have a positive impact on its members? 

GALA is a hub where we grow, learn, and succeed together. It anticipates change, sets industry trends, and equips its members with the insights needed to navigate an evolving business landscape. By fostering a strong sense of community, GALA brings forward the latest innovations, technologies, and market developments to prepare members for the realities of tomorrow, helping them remain competitive today. In addition, GALA serves as a powerful advocate for the localization industry, amplifying its voice across sectors and highlighting the vital role of language in driving business success.

You get a warm welcome into the world of language, technology and outstanding professionals from all over the world, which only makes you stay longer.

Why would you make a good GALA board member? What will you bring to the table?

I’ve been a member of the Board of the Bulgarian National Aeroclub for several years. During my student years, I served as president of an organization (now inactive). Before joining 1-StopAsia, I gained 12 years of experience in sales. At 1-StopAsia, I’ve curated our internal Sales Training programs and worked extensively on Growth Strategies, M&A, and identifying new business opportunities. I have a deep understanding of creating value through marketing and content curation, as well as building teams and processes from the ground up. 

Which segment(s) of GALA's membership do you represent? What perspective will you bring?

Language Service Provider with LSP to LSP scope, deep understanding of how the bottleneck of the industry works and what the dynamics are in the supply chain. Being mid-size gives us an insight into all levels and good feeling of what the pulse is among small and big.
